       I rebuilt flink from the source           and specified the vendor 
specific             Hadoop version. It works well when i just submit a 
streaming             application  without '-d'(--detached) option as follows:
       bin/flink run -m yarn-cluster           -yqu root.streaming -yn 5 -yjm 
2048 -ytm 3096 -ynm           CJVFormatter -ys 2 -c yidian.data.cjv.Formatter   
        ./cjv-formatter-1.0-SNAPSHOT.jar --conf ./formatter.conf
       
       
       But if i add the '-d'(--detached)           option,  a 
'org.apache.flink.client.deployment.ClusterDeploymentException'           will 
be thrown out to the CLI. Just as:
       bin/flink           run -d -m yarn-cluster -yqu root.streaming -yn       
    5 -yjm 2048 -ytm 3096 -ynm CJVFormatter -ys 2 -c           
yidian.data.cjv.Formatter ./cjv-formatter-1.0-SNAPSHOT.jar           --conf 
./formatter.conf

       When I rebuild the flink from source, I           used the command:
       mvn clean install -DskipTests           -Dhadoop.version=2.6.0-cdh5.5.0
       
         
       My cluster details:
                Hadoop 2.6.0-cdh5.5.0
         Subversion             http://github.com/cloudera/hadoop -r            
 fd21232cef7b8c1f536965897ce20f50b83ee7b2
         Compiled by jenkins on 2015-11-09T20:39Z
         Compiled with protoc 2.5.0
         From source with checksum             98e07176d1787150a6a9c087627562c
         This command was run using 
/opt/cloudera/parcels/CDH-5.5.0-1.cdh5.5.0.p0.8/jars/hadoop-common-2.6.0-cdh5.5.0.jar
       
       
       
       I am wondering that I have specified the vendor specific Hadoop          
 version, how did this happened? Or is there anything or extra           
parameters should be added?
